- The Hong Kong Customs and Excise Department(ED) takes part actively in WCO business. It also participates in the organisation's Policy Commission.
- The trade controls branch of the customs and Excise Department(ED) is responsible for enforcing various trade control systems, including the certification of origin system, the textiles import and export control system, the strategic commodities control system and the import and export declaration system.
